For large scale protoplast transformation of the moss Physcomitrella patens (Hedw.) B.S.G. semicontinuous protonema suspension cultures in bioreactors were established and optimised with regard to the yield of protoplasts. Supplementation of Knop medium with 2.5 mM ammonium tartrate markedly improved the protoplast yield (7.4 x 10(4) protoplasts/mg dry weight). Bioreactor culture was performed in 5 1 vessels. By harvesting on average I 100 ml/day which corresponds to a dilution rate of 0.22/d a semicontinuous culture was maintained for 49 days yielding 51 1 of suspension culture. Beginning eleven days after the start of the bioreactor run around 6 % of the cells were polyploid (4C) which might indicate aging of the culture caused by phytohormone accumulation.
